Active time awareness refers to the ability of individuals to consciously recognize how time is being experienced, used, and perceived during activities rather than only noticing time after it has passed. In modern digital environments, where interactions are designed to be smooth and continuous, users often lose track of duration, transitions, and personal limits. Cultivating active time awareness helps people remain engaged without feeling disconnected from their own schedules, energy levels, or intentions. It transforms time from an invisible background element into a supportive guide that enhances clarity, autonomy, and satisfaction.
When people engage with digital systems, time perception frequently shifts. Moments may feel shorter during highly stimulating experiences and longer during passive waiting. This psychological elasticity can lead users to underestimate how long they have been involved in an activity. Active time awareness counters this effect by gently reconnecting users with temporal context. Instead of interrupting engagement, well-designed cues allow individuals to maintain immersion while still understanding the passage of time.
One important aspect of active time awareness is transparency. Systems that acknowledge duration openly help users build trust. Simple indicators such as elapsed session timers, progress markers, or natural pause points provide subtle reminders without creating pressure. These signals do not force users to stop; instead, they offer information that supports informed decisions. When people understand how long they have been active, they regain a sense of control over their participation.
Equally important is rhythm. Human attention works best in cycles rather than endless continuity. Interfaces that respect natural pacing encourage healthier interaction patterns. Periodic summaries, gentle checkpoints, or optional reflection moments help users reassess whether they want to continue, pause, or change tasks. These moments reinforce awareness without breaking flow. Over time, users begin to internalize these rhythms, developing stronger self-regulation habits.
Active time awareness also benefits emotional experience. Unnoticed overextension often leads to fatigue or frustration, even when the activity itself is enjoyable. By contrast, when users remain conscious of duration, engagement feels intentional rather than accidental. This distinction significantly influences satisfaction. People are more likely to associate positive feelings with experiences they actively chose to continue rather than those that quietly consumed unexpected amounts of time.
Design language plays a key role in reinforcing awareness. Messaging should remain neutral and supportive rather than corrective or judgmental. Statements framed as helpful information—such as reminders of elapsed time or suggestions to take breaks—encourage reflection without creating resistance. The goal is not to restrict behavior but to empower users with context. Respectful communication strengthens the relationship between user and system by demonstrating consideration for personal wellbeing.
Another dimension involves predictability. When users know approximately how long an activity or interaction phase will last, they can align it with their real-world responsibilities. Clear expectations reduce anxiety and increase willingness to engage. For example, indicating estimated completion time or session length helps users decide whether to proceed immediately or postpone participation. Predictability transforms time management into a collaborative process between user and platform.
Active time awareness is particularly effective when combined with adaptive personalization. Individuals differ in how they perceive time and manage attention. Some prefer frequent reminders, while others benefit from minimal prompts. Allowing customizable awareness settings respects these differences. Adjustable notification intervals, optional time displays, or selectable session limits give users ownership over how awareness is presented. Personal control reinforces autonomy and reduces the likelihood of reminders feeling intrusive.
Visual design also contributes significantly. Time indicators should be visible yet calm, avoiding visual urgency that may create stress. Gradual progress visuals, soft transitions, or unobtrusive counters integrate awareness naturally into the interface. When time cues blend harmoniously with the environment, users absorb information effortlessly rather than perceiving it as an interruption. Effective design ensures awareness feels like guidance rather than surveillance.
Beyond individual interactions, active time awareness supports long-term behavioral balance. When users consistently receive accurate feedback about how they spend time, patterns become easier to recognize. Reflection leads to adjustment. People may notice preferred engagement windows, optimal session lengths, or moments when breaks improve focus. Over time, this awareness promotes healthier digital habits grounded in personal insight rather than external enforcement.
Importantly, active time awareness should always remain optional and respectful. Forced interruptions or rigid limitations can undermine trust and reduce enjoyment. The purpose is to inform, not to control. Systems succeed when they provide clear opportunities for choice while honoring user autonomy. A well-balanced approach encourages responsibility while preserving freedom.
In collaborative or shared environments, time awareness can enhance coordination as well. Shared progress indicators or synchronized session timing help participants align expectations. When everyone understands how time is unfolding within a shared activity, communication becomes smoother and misunderstandings decrease. Collective awareness fosters cooperation without requiring constant verbal clarification.
The broader significance of active time awareness extends beyond usability into ethical design philosophy. Digital experiences increasingly occupy meaningful portions of daily life, making it essential that systems acknowledge users as people with finite attention and diverse responsibilities. Designing for awareness demonstrates respect for human limits. It recognizes that success is not measured solely by duration of engagement but by quality and intentionality of experience.
As technology continues evolving, active time awareness will likely become a defining element of responsible interaction design. Rather than competing for maximum attention, forward-thinking systems will aim to support balanced participation. By helping users remain conscious of time while staying engaged, platforms can create experiences that feel both immersive and grounded.
Ultimately, active time awareness strengthens the connection between intention and action. It allows individuals to participate fully while remaining aligned with personal priorities. Through transparency, rhythm, respectful messaging, and thoughtful visual integration, awareness becomes an empowering companion to engagement. When time is made visible in supportive ways, users experience greater clarity, confidence, and lasting satisfaction in how they choose to spend their moments.
